WebJan 22, 2024 · The postage meter rate to send a 1-ounce USPS Certified Mail® letter with a Return Receipt (old-fashioned Green Card) will be $8.10. If you use Certified Mail Labels with Electronic Delivery Confirmation, the cost can be reduced to $5.65. Additional options such as Return Receipt Electronic Signatures will cost $2.10.

WebJun 14, 2024 · The delivery person can't leave Certified Mail without a signature. If no one is home to receive it, the postal worker will leave a note that a delivery attempt was made. USPS only makes one delivery attempt. After that, the carrier returns the letter or package to the nearest post office.5 days ago. Can you sue USPS for lost certified mail? Web2.
